The bed and breakfast "Lavender and Rosemary" is set in the tranquility of the Umbrian countryside, surrounded by ancient olive trees and bushes of lavender and rosemary, just a short walk from the historic center. Here, where our grandparents once lived, the harmony with nature and the scents of the land intertwine with childhood memories, creating an authentic and relaxing atmosphere.

The property is a newly built villa that maintains a connection to tradition, offering well-kept and welcoming spaces. The rooms, all double with private bathrooms and air conditioning, are inspired by the colors of the surrounding nature: the silvery green of the olive trees, the shades of roses, the yellow of broom, and the deep purple of lavender. Every detail is designed to ensure comfort and well-being in a setting of peace and beauty.

The day begins with a generous homemade breakfast featuring pastries and artisanal jams, served in the bright dining room or under the panoramic porch overlooking the Umbrian valley. Its strategic location allows guests to alternate between relaxation and walks in the countryside or in the nearby historic center, as well as easily reach the main attractions of the region. For cycling enthusiasts, guided excursions on scenic routes are available.

Just a short distance away is the Church of San Damiano, a place of deep spirituality where St. Francis composed the Canticle of the Creatures and St. Clare founded the Order of the Poor Ladies. Even today, the silence and peace that envelop this corner of Umbria offer a unique and rejuvenating experience.

We welcome you with a delightful breakfast that features the extraordinary cakes lovingly made by our mother, Carla.

Additionally, you can enjoy artisanal cookies, including the traditional Umbrian "tozzetti," fresh pastries, Nutella, homemade jams, butter, honey, yogurt, and a variety of cereals, all accompanied by many other treats.

To cater to every taste, we will prepare excellent espresso coffee, creamy cappuccino, hot chocolate, tea or herbal infusions, as well as fruit juices in various flavors, hot or cold milk, and chocolate milk for the little ones.

Upon request, we also offer savory options and products suitable for those with specific allergies or intolerances.

The bed and breakfast is situated in a unique location, just a short walk from the historic center but already enveloped in the tranquility of the Umbrian countryside. Here, among ancient olive trees and lavender bushes, one can feel an atmosphere of peace and harmony, ideal for those looking to unwind without sacrificing the convenience of having everything close at hand.

Not far away stands the Church of San Damiano, a place rich in history and spirituality, where Saint Francis composed the Canticle of the Creatures and Saint Clare established the order of the Poor Clares. The silence that surrounds this corner of Umbria, combined with the beauty of the landscape, provides a captivating and rejuvenating experience.

Thanks to its strategic location, guests can easily alternate between nature walks and visits to the nearby historic center, which is filled with art, culture, and charming views. The main attractions of the region are easily accessible by both car and public transport, offering endless opportunities for exploration among medieval towns, gastronomic routes, and spiritual itineraries.

For outdoor enthusiasts, the area features trails perfect for hiking and cycling, with options to organize guided excursions to discover the enchanting landscapes of Umbria. This territory captivates with its authenticity and invites visitors to enjoy a slow and engaging travel experience amid nature, history, and tradition.
